Before you sign

What to ask a Corpus Christi contractor first

  1. 01

    How does the lease split responsibility between landlord and tenant for this repair, as that determines who authorises the work?

  2. 02

    Which occupancy class and code chapter govern this building, since commercial fixture counts and venting rules differ from residential work?

  3. 03

    Can the work proceed outside trading hours, and how will tenants and staff be notified before water is isolated?

How is commercial plumbing different from residential?

Larger pipe sizing, different code classifications, mandated devices like grease interceptors and testable backflow assemblies, documented compliance reporting, and the fact that downtime has a direct revenue cost. Not every residential contractor is set up for it.

How often does a grease trap need service?

It is set by local health regulation and by how fast the trap fills — many jurisdictions require documented service on a fixed interval with retained manifests. Check your local requirement rather than waiting for an odour complaint.

Who handles backflow testing?

A tester with a state or water-purveyor backflow certification, which is a separate credential from a plumbing licence. Most water purveyors require an annual test with the report filed directly with them.

Do I need a permit for plumbing work in Corpus Christi?

Permit requirements around Corpus Christi are set locally rather than statewide. As a rule, water heater replacement, gas work, sewer laterals and repiping are permitted work, while a like-for-like faucet or disposal swap usually is not. A licensed contractor pulls the permit — if one offers to skip it, that is the signal to stop.

How should a commercial quote be compared?

Line by line against scope: what is included, what is excluded, who pulls the permit, and whether haul-away and restoration are inside the number. The cost guides on this site list published third-party ranges so any quote can be sanity-checked.
